What cracks me up is dealing with about 45 banks who have 45 different ways of doing a heloc or re fi
Yes the basic docs …but this one wants the cd initialed. This one doesnt
Initial the mortgage for them …
but they dont require it
Pages of instructions and policy we print
Our signature required as we attest to a doc review…i understand that one but not everyone requires it lol
I use "sign here " stickers on every signing ,no matter how many times i have worked for that bank or mortgage company
If i see a new form or doc and have a question, i call the loan officer or title company
They all thank me for making sure im doing the job properly
Any signing company i work with says the same thing
I leave my ego at the door …dont be afraid to ask a question until you understand the answer

Everyone please be vigilant as a Business Owner and perform due diligence regarding vetting of your potential new clients. Many online lists (the following included: “123 notary has a complete list of signing companies on his website”) have dated/old info & some are no longer in business, some have become non-payers or very, very slow payment.
